A batsman hits a cricket ball high in the air. Neglecting air resistance, the ball's horizontal component of speed is constant because it:

Ais not acted upon by any forces
Bis not acted upon by gravitational sources
Cis not acted upon by any vertical forces
Dis not acted upon by any horizontal forces
Correct Answer

Solution

When a batsman hits a cricket ball in air , it follows the projectile motion . As there is no acceleration (so , no force ) in horizontal direction , therefore horizontal speed remains constant through the whole journey . Whereas vertical speed changes due to gravitational acceleration .
